
Jadé Fadojutimi
Jadé Fadojutimi is a British painter known for her vibrant, large-scale abstract works that she describes as “emotional landscapes.” Born in London in 1993, she studied at the Slade School of Fine Art and the Royal College of Art. Her dynamic, layered paintings draw on influences from anime, fashion, and music, exploring themes of identity, memory, and self-reflection. Fadojutimi has exhibited internationally, including at the Venice Biennale and ICA Miami, and is represented by Gagosian. Her work is held in major collections such as Tate, the Met, and LACMA.
